The transformer winding table coordinates critical parameters such as wire gauge, winding pitch, layer insulation, and core alignment. These factors directly influence key performance metrics including impedance matching, voltage regulation, and heat dissipation. By standardizing winding sequences and spacing, engineers minimize electromagnetic interference and maximize energy transfer efficiency. Modern winding tables integrate digital simulation tools to model real-world conditions, enabling proactive engineering decisions.
